Definitions

from The Century Dictionary.

  • noun A machine or apparatus for stretching or stentering muslins and other thin fabrics. Also called stenter-hook.
  • To operate upon (thin cotton fabrics, as book-muslins, etc.) in a manner to impart to them a so-called elastic finish.
